The Venezuela Telescope Market is characterized by a growing demand for both amateur and professional telescopes. With a rising interest in astronomy and astrophotography among individuals and educational institutions, the market is witnessing an increase in sales of telescopes of various types such as refractor, reflector, and compound telescopes. The market is dominated by both local and international manufacturers offering a wide range of products catering to different skill levels and budgets. Factors such as technological advancements, increasing disposable income, and a growing emphasis on STEM education are driving the market growth. However, economic challenges and import restrictions present significant barriers to market expansion. Overall, the Venezuela Telescope Market shows promise for continued growth, especially as more people show interest in exploring the wonders of the universe.

The Venezuela Telescope Market faces several challenges primarily due to the country`s economic and political instability. The fluctuations in the local currency, high inflation rates, and limited access to foreign currency make it difficult for consumers to afford telescopes, impacting the overall demand in the market. Additionally, the lack of technological infrastructure and funding for research and development hinders the growth of the telescope industry in Venezuela. Import restrictions and trade barriers further restrict the availability of quality telescopes in the market, forcing consumers to rely on outdated or low-quality products. These challenges collectively contribute to a stagnant and underdeveloped telescope market in Venezuela, limiting opportunities for growth and innovation in the industry.

Government policies related to the Venezuela Telescope Market primarily focus on import regulations, licensing requirements, and taxation. The Venezuelan government has implemented strict controls on imports, which can impact the availability and pricing of telescopes in the market. Importers must comply with licensing requirements and may face challenges in obtaining necessary permits for bringing telescopes into the country. Additionally, telescopes are subject to taxation, including customs duties and value-added tax, which can further increase the cost of these products for consumers. These policies create barriers to entry for international telescope manufacturers and distributors looking to penetrate the Venezuelan market, while also potentially limiting access to telescopes for local consumers due to higher prices and limited availability.
The future outlook for the Venezuela Telescope Market is challenging due to the country`s economic and political instability. The ongoing economic crisis and hyperinflation have severely impacted consumer purchasing power, leading to a decline in demand for non-essential goods such as telescopes. Additionally, the lack of technological advancements and infrastructure development in the country further hinders the growth of the telescope market. The political situation, including international sanctions and trade restrictions, also creates uncertainties for businesses operating in Venezuela. Overall, the Venezuela Telescope Market is likely to face continued challenges in the foreseeable future, with limited growth opportunities unless significant improvements are made in the country`s economic and political environment.
